Rights of 45,000 Mental Health Sufferers in Armenia Not Defended
According to the Vanadzor Office of the Helsinki Citizens’ Assembly, there are 45,000 individuals in Armenia suffering from a variety of mental health disorders whose rights aren’t being defended.
The civic organization states that Armenia, a signatory to the U.N.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ities, has failed to fulfill a number of obligations in this sector.
The Assembly argues that those with mental disorders remain alienated from their communities and social life in general and cannot defend their rights effectively.
